Why the Spokane Riverfront Is a Dream for Portrait Photography
Spokane's downtown riverfront corridor offers something you simply can't manufacture in a studio: raw, natural beauty layered with character. The rushing water of Spokane Falls, the lush green banks of the Spokane River, the iconic clock tower and bridges, the Centennial Trail weaving through trees — it all combines into a location that works for virtually any style of photography.
Whether you want dramatic, editorial portraits with the mist of the falls in the background, or soft, romantic images surrounded by summer foliage, the Spokane Riverfront delivers.
Here's why photographers and clients love it:
Variety in a small area. Within just a few blocks, you can move from open sky over the river to shaded wooded paths to urban bridge backdrops — no driving required.
Iconic Spokane character. The falls, the pavilion, the historic bridges — these aren't just pretty; they tell the story of this place, giving your photos a sense of belonging.
Gorgeous light. The open sky over the river creates beautiful, even light in the morning, and absolutely magical golden light in the evening as the sun dips toward the west.
Accessible and comfortable. The paved paths, open lawns, and nearby parking make it easy for families with young children, seniors, or anyone who just wants a relaxed, enjoyable session.
Best Spots Along the Spokane Riverfront for Photos
Not all riverfront locations are created equal. Here are a few of our favorites:
Riverfront Park is the obvious starting point. The sprawling park offers multiple environments: the grassy Meadow, the iconic red wagon sculpture, wooded paths, and the river itself. It's endlessly versatile.
The Spokane Falls Viewpoints offer dramatic, high-energy backdrops. The mist and motion of the water create a sense of life and movement in photos that's hard to replicate anywhere else.
The Centennial Trail winds along the river both east and west of downtown, offering quieter, more natural surroundings — perfect for couples who want something intimate and organic rather than urban.
The Monroe Street Bridge is one of the most underrated photography locations in the city. The architecture, the river below, the tree canopy — it's stunning, especially in late afternoon light.

What to Wear for Your Spokane Riverfront Session
The riverfront's color palette tends to be rich greens, warm stone grays, and deep blues — especially in summer. Here are a few tips to help your wardrobe shine:
Opt for earthy, natural tones. Sage, olive, dusty rose, cream, warm tan, and soft blues all photograph beautifully against the water and greenery.
Avoid bright neon or overly busy patterns. These can compete with the stunning backdrop and distract the eye away from you.
Coordinate, don't match. For families and couples, aim for a cohesive color palette rather than identical outfits — it looks more natural and relaxed.
Dress in layers if shooting in the morning. Spokane mornings near the river can be cooler, even in summer.
Wear comfortable shoes. You'll be walking on grass, pavement, and gravel — practical footwear matters.
The Best Time of Year to Book a Spokane Riverfront Session
Honestly, the riverfront is beautiful in every season — but summer reigns supreme. June through August offers long golden hours (6:30 to 8:30 PM is prime light), lush green foliage and full tree canopy, warm comfortable temperatures for you and your family, and the river running full and gorgeous from snowmelt.
